Here’s a great clip of Cali-based singer-songwriter Brett Dennen performing “Crazy Love, Vol. II” off of Paul Simon’s Graceland. It’s the first in a series of exclusive covers from indie bands, as part of the album’s 25th anniversary celebration (the Gracelandbox set hits stores June 5).

The low-key video was shot during a backpacking trip that Dennen took in the Sierra Mountains.

Graceland is my all time favorite album,” Dennen tells American Songwriter. “You can probably hear it in my music. It came out when I was really young, my parents were big Paul Simon fans, and the album shaped my whole taste in music. I think ‘Crazy Love, Vol. II’ doesn’t get enough credit, because there’s so many hits on the album that get all the attention, but it is in no way, an album track. It’s one of Paul Simon’s best songs.”
